John Gray to direct 'Hanging Tree' film

NEW YORK, Aug. 4 (UPI) -- New York filmmaker John Gray says he plans to adapt author Bryan Gruley's mystery thriller "The Hanging Tree" for the big screen.

Gray wrote and directed last spring's festival hit "White Irish Drinkers" and created the TV series "The Ghost Whisperer."

He said he acquired the film rights for "Tree" through his company, Ovington Avenue Productions, and will pen the screenplay for and direct the film, as well as produce it with his producing partner Melissa Jo Peltier.

"The Hanging Tree" is the second book in the best-selling Starvation Lake mystery series.

"Bryan Gruley has written a brilliant series of novels, with rich characters in an incredibly visual and fascinating world. The themes in this particular novel resonated deeply with me, and I'm passionate about bringing it to the screen," Gray said in a statement Tuesday.
